Deadman Ridge Trail
This very steep climb rises in Idaho. Expect 47 to 80 minutes. The hardest 500 metres average 39.7% and start 2.3 km in, so the worst of it lands when you are already committed. South-facing, so it is hot in summer and one of the first to clear of snow. At 20.0 TEP it is harder than 94% of the climbs in the catalogue.
